'Almond Souffle ( Amandes soufflees )
One and a half cups milk, one tablespoon butter, one tablespoon flour, two tablespoons sherry, a small pinch of salt, four table¬ spoons almond paste, four eggs, five tablespoons sugar.
How to Make It. Put the milk on the stove to get hot. Put the butter in a saucepan, then add the flour, milk, sherry, salt, and almond paste (or finely chopped almonds); leave to get cold. In the meantime, stir the yolks to a souffle with five tablespoons
sugar and add to the mixture, beat the whites of the eggs to a meringue, and add. Mix very carefully. Butter and sugar a deep form or souffle dish and fill, sprinkle sugar on top, put in a pan of boiling water and bake — uncovered — from twenty to thirty minutes according to the heat of the oven.
Send in hot water up to the pantry. There it should be put in a silver dish and served immediately with a cold foam sauce.
Brandy Souffle ( Cognac souffle)
Three eggs, four tablespoons powdered sugar, two tablespoons brandy, a small pinch of salt. Stir yolks, sugar, and salt to a souffle; add brandy; beat whites of eggs very stiff, add carefully. Butter a souffle dish, sprinkle with sugar, fill, sprinkle sugar on the top. Bake in hot water from twenty to twenty-five minutes, send up to the pantry in hot water until ready to serve, then take out, put in a silver dish, and serve with cold foam sauce.
Peach Souffle ( Peches soufflees)
Take one cup mashed peaches — fresh, canned, or glassed. Put one heaping tablespoon flour in a saucepan with cup hot milk and three tablespoons brandy, beat until nice and smooth, add the peaches, let come to a boil, take off the stove, leave until cold. Beat three-quarters cup sugar with yolks of three eggs to a souffle, add to the mixture; last add the whites of the eggs — well beaten. Put in a souffle dish that has been well buttered, sprinkle wtih powdered sugar, putin hot water, bake in oven from fifteen to twentyfive minutes — according to heat of the oven. Serve hot with a peach foam sauce.
Orange Souffle ( Orange souffle) a la Ericsson Hammond
Put in a saucepan on the stove the juice of three oranges and the rind of one with one cup water. When hot, put one table¬ spoon butter in a pan, add one heaping tablespoon flour, mix well, add the orange juice and water, stir until it becomes smooth; leave until cold, add the yolks of four eggs that have been stirred with five tablespoons sugar to a souffle, last add whites of the eggs — well beaten. Butter and sugar a souffle dish well, put at the bottom of it the meat of one to two oranges — cut in small dices; put the souffle on top. Sprinkle with sugar. Bake in oven until raised and well browned on top. Serve immediately with foam sauce.
